Course Overview
This course equips learners with a deep understanding of supply chain dynamics, strategy, and execution. Covering planning, logistics, IT, analytics, and sustainability, it prepares students to analyze, manage, and optimize modern supply chains across industries and geographies.
Mode: Online | Duration: 30 Hours | Credits: 2 | Level: Intermediate
What You’ll Learn
By the end of this course, you will be able to:
-
Define the core concepts and performance metrics of supply chain management
-
Analyze supply chain stages and identify areas for optimization
-
Apply planning tools including forecasting, inventory, and network design
-
Understand logistics operations such as production scheduling and transportation
-
Leverage technologies like ERP, AI, and blockchain in supply chain visibility
-
Incorporate sustainable and socially responsible practices into SCM
-
Explore emerging trends like e-commerce, industry 4.0, and global disruptions
-
Analyze real-world case studies including COVID-19, Suez Canal blockage, and India’s resilient supply chain strategies
